Abstract
The invention discloses a cleaning device for automobile parts, which comprises a cleaning box, a water tank and a cleaning assembly, wherein the cleaning assembly comprises a guide pipe, a support shaft and a rotating pipe, the top of the support shaft penetrates through a gap between a first support plate and a second support plate to be fixedly provided with a planetary gear, the rotating pipe is fixedly provided with a sun gear, the planetary gear is in gear connection with a gear ring and the sun gear, the support shaft is fixedly provided with a fixing assembly for fixing the automobile parts, the bottom of the cleaning box is provided with a water outlet pipe, the cleaning box is also provided with a drying assembly, the device drives the sun gear on the rotating pipe to rotate by a driving motor to drive the planetary gear to rotate around the gear ring, so that the automobile parts on the support shaft can be fully and comprehensively cleaned, the cleaning efficiency of the device is high, the water tank is fixedly provided with a filter box for filtering water flowing out from the cleaning box, reuse water resource still dries auto parts through setting up drying device.

Example 1
Referring to fig. 1 to 3, in the embodiment of the present invention, a cleaning device for automobile parts includes a cleaning tank 1, a cleaning assembly disposed in the cleaning tank 1, and a water tank 5 fixedly disposed at the bottom of the cleaning tank 1, where the cleaning assembly includes a guide tube 3, a support shaft 13, and a rotating tube 17, a first sealing cover 10 is fixedly disposed on an inner wall of a top portion of the water tank 5, a water inlet tube 6 is fixedly disposed at the bottom of the cleaning tank 1, the water inlet tube 6 is communicated with the first sealing cover 10, the rotating tube 17 is rotatably disposed at the top of the cleaning tank 1, a driving motor 15 is fixedly disposed at the top of the cleaning tank 1, the top of the rotating tube 17 is in transmission connection with an output end of the driving motor 15 through a belt 16, a rotating cavity 12 is fixedly disposed at the other end of the rotating tube 17 and is communicated with the rotating cavity 12, a first support plate 2 is fixedly disposed above the cleaning tank 1, a, the rotating pipe 17 is rotatably provided with a second supporting plate 21, the second supporting plate 21 and the first supporting plate 2 are located at the same height, the top of the supporting shaft 13 penetrates through a gap between the first supporting plate 2 and the second supporting plate 21 and is fixedly provided with a planetary gear 22, the rotating pipe 17 is fixedly provided with a sun gear 24, the planetary gear 22, a gear ring 23 and the sun gear 24 are in uniform tooth joint, the bottom of the supporting shaft 13 is arranged on the inner wall of the bottom of the cleaning box 1 in a rolling manner through a roller 11, the supporting shaft 13 is fixedly provided with a fixing component for fixing automobile parts, the guide pipe 3 is fixedly arranged on the side wall of the cleaning box 1, the guide pipe 3 penetrates through the water tank 5 and is communicated with the first sealing cover 10, the guide pipe 3 and the rotating cavity 12 are both communicated with a plurality of spray heads 4, the first sealing cover 10 is communicated with the water tank 5 through a water pipe 9, a water pump 8 is arranged on, the bottom of wasing case 1 is provided with outlet pipe 28, fix auto parts on the fixed subassembly on back shaft 13, start water pump 8 and take out the water in the water tank 5 to first sealed intracavity 10, through pipe 3 and the shower nozzle 4 blowout on rotating chamber 12, start driving motor 15 and drive pipe 17 and rotate, it rotates to drive rotating chamber 12, pipe 17 drives planetary gear 22 through sun gear 24 simultaneously around the rotation in ring gear 23 pivoted, and then the auto parts on back shaft 13 can obtain abundant comprehensive washing, and the cleaning efficiency of this device is high.
The structure body of the fixed assembly price is not limited, in this embodiment, preferably, the fixed assembly includes a bracket 27 and a fixture block 25, the bracket 27 is fixedly mounted on the support shaft 13, a sliding groove is formed in the bracket 27, the fixture block 25 is slidably clamped in the sliding groove formed in the bracket 27, the fixture block 25 is elastically connected with the bracket 27 through a spring 26, and the automobile part is hung on the bracket 27 and is fixed through the fixture block 25 under the action of the spring 26.
The number of the planetary gears 22 and the support shafts 13 is not particularly limited, and in this embodiment, it is preferable that the number of the planetary gears 22 and the support shafts 13 is six.
The number of the conduits 3 is not particularly limited, and in this embodiment, it is preferable that the number of the conduits 3 is four.
In order to facilitate the discharge of the cleaned water and impurities through the outlet pipe 28, the bottom of the cleaning tank 1 is inclined.
The water tank 5 is fixedly provided with a filter box 30, the top of the filter box 30 is communicated with a water outlet pipe 28, the bottom of the filter box 30 is communicated with the water tank 5, a filter screen 29 is fixedly arranged in the filter box 30, the filter screen 29 is obliquely arranged, water in the cleaning box 1 enters the filter box 30 through the water outlet pipe 28, is filtered by the filter screen 29 and then flows back to the water tank 31, and therefore the water resource is recycled.
Example 2
This example is a further improvement on example 1, and compared with example 1, the main difference is that: the top of the cleaning box 1 is fixedly provided with a hot air blower 20, a second sealing cover 14 and a third sealing cover 18, the output end of the hot air blower 20 is communicated with the third sealing cover 18, the output end of the hot air blower 20 is provided with a second one-way valve 19, the duct 3 is communicated with the second sealing cover 14, the rotating pipe 17 is positioned inside the second sealing cover 14 and the third sealing cover 18 and is provided with a through hole, the water pipe 9 is provided with a first one-way valve 7, after the automobile parts are cleaned, the water pump 8 is closed, the hot air blower 20 is started, hot air enters the first sealing cover 14 through the second sealing cavity 18 and the rotating pipe 17 and then is blown out through the nozzle 4 on the guide pipe 3, the hot air also enters the rotating cavity 12 through the rotating pipe 17 and is blown out through the nozzle 4, the automobile parts are comprehensively dried, and the first check valve 7 and the second check valve 19 are arranged for preventing hot air from entering the water tank 31 when the automobile parts are dried and water from entering the air heater when the automobile parts are cleaned.
The working principle of the invention is as follows: after the auto parts washs the completion, close water pump 8, start air heater 20, hot-blast second seal chamber 18 and the bull pipe 17 of passing through get into first sealed cowling 14, shower nozzle 4 on the rethread pipe 3 blows off, hot-blast still gets into through the bull pipe 17 simultaneously and blows off in rotating chamber 12 through shower nozzle 4, carry out comprehensive drying to the auto parts, the purpose of setting up first check valve 7 and second check valve 19 is in hot-blast entering water tank 31 and the water entering air heater when the auto parts washs when preventing the auto parts to dry.
